Mission Moments: Carmen’s Story

When Carmen reached out to our Patient Navigator for help getting an INR meter for home use, it opened the door to a life-changing solution for Carmen.
An INR meter is a small medical device that helps patients check how quickly their blood clots. People who take blood thinner medications often need regular INR testing to make sure their medication is working safely. Usually, this means frequent trips to a clinic or lab for blood draws.

At first, our Patient Navigator had never worked with a home INR monitoring system before. But after researching options, they discovered a local company that could provide the equipment, training, and support right in the patient’s home.
The process took teamwork and persistence. After a few unsuccessful attempts to fax paperwork to the durable medical equipment (DME) company, a sales representative personally visited the clinic to collect the orders in person. Once the paperwork was submitted and insurance approval was received, Carmen received her home monitoring system and training within about a month.
Just one week later, Carmen was still excited about her new equipment. Not only does the home INR meter help her stay on top of her health, but it also saves her trips to medical appointments and gives her more time with the people who matter most — her family.
